Mid America Pulling Association (MAPA) is an organization of garden tractor pullers in central Iowa. The club was founded in 1983 and still runs about 15-20 pulls every year between June and September.
Each pull showcases a wide variety of classes ranging from a Stock class for kids under the age of 15, a Stock Altered class, a Super Stock class, a Modified class, and an Outlaw class. Each class runs a light and a heavy weight. A pull averages about 50 hooks, but in the last few years there have been as many as 75.
